Can you save a story as a draft on a writing platform?
Sure. Usually, when you're using a reliable writing app or website, there's a 'Save as Draft' button or similar option. This is handy if you need to come back and finish or edit your story at another time. Different platforms might have slightly different names or placements for this feature, but it's pretty standard.

What are the advantages of using Final Draft for novel writing?
Using Final Draft for a novel can be great because it offers a distraction - free writing environment. There are no unnecessary pop - ups or distractions while you're in the creative flow. It also has a powerful search function. If you're trying to find a specific scene, character name, or plot point, you can quickly locate it. Additionally, the software allows for easy version control, so you can keep track of different drafts and changes you've made over time.

Is the cover of the novel a commercial draft or a private draft?
If the cover of the novel is for commercial use, such as for commercial publication or display on a commercial platform to attract readers, and the first party is an enterprise (such as a publishing house) or a platform, the first party has the right to use the work, and the artist has the right to publish and the right to sign the work. What are the key elements to consider when writing a first draft short story?
When writing a first draft short story, the most important thing is to start writing. Just let your ideas flow. Don't be afraid to make mistakes. A simple but effective element is dialogue. It can bring your characters to life. For instance, if two characters are arguing, the way they talk can show their personalities. Also, think about the conflict in the story. It could be internal, like a character's struggle with their own fears, or external, like a battle against a villain. This conflict drives the story forward.
